- Download 100% Free PC Games | Download GamesSponsoredThe Best Free Downloadable Games Reviewed. Find the Best Game Here & Play …- Top 5 Downloadable Games · Beginner Friendly · Beginner to Pro Levels 
Top 5 Downloadable Games · Beginner Friendly · Beginner to Pro Levels
 Feedback
Feedback